Wood window services typically involve a range of repairs, restorations, and maintenance tasks aimed at preserving the functionality and appearance of wooden windows. These services can include replacing damaged or rotted wood, re-glazing panes, repairing or replacing window sashes, and refinishing or repainting to restore the original look. Skilled professionals assess the condition of existing wood components and perform targeted work to address issues such as warping, cracking, or deterioration caused by exposure to the elements over time. The goal is to extend the lifespan of the windows while maintaining their aesthetic appeal and structural integrity.

One of the primary issues that wood window services help resolve is air leakage, which can lead to increased energy costs and reduced indoor comfort. Over time, wood windows may develop gaps or become warped, compromising their ability to insulate properly. Additionally, damaged wood can lead to leaks that allow drafts, moisture infiltration, and even pest entry. Restoration services also address cosmetic concerns, such as peeling paint or weathered finishes, helping to improve curb appeal. By repairing or replacing compromised components, these services help ensure that windows remain functional, energy-efficient, and visually appealing.

The overview below groups typical Wood Window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Sykesville, MD.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Replacement Window Costs - The cost for replacing wood windows typically ranges from $300 to $800 per window, depending on size and style. For example, a standard-sized window may cost around $500 on average. Prices can vary based on the window's complexity and local labor rates.

Repair Service Expenses - Repair costs for wood windows generally fall between $150 and $400 per window. Minor repairs like sash restoration tend to be on the lower end, while extensive frame repairs may be more costly. Actual prices depend on the extent of damage and local service providers.

Custom Wood Window Pricing - Custom-designed wood windows can range from $600 to over $1,200 each, influenced by materials, design complexity, and size. Custom features and finishes may increase the overall cost, with local pros providing tailored quotes.

Maintenance and Restoration Costs - Restorative services such as sanding, refinishing, or sealing typically cost between $200 and $600 per window. These services help preserve the wood and improve appearance, with prices varying based on the scope of work and window size.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
